The Collaborative for High Performance Schools, also known as CHPS, is a national nonprofit organization dedicated to making every school an ideal place to learn. CHPS works with schools, architectural teams other school stakeholders to develop and implement standards for healthy, high performance K-12 educational facilities across the country.
Duties:
- Assist design teams with project intake, payment, progress, and recognition; monitors record keeping and file maintenance for the program or project
- Coordinates and attends meetings; establishes and maintains internal and external contacts as necessary;
- Prepares records of project activities; oversees and ensures the timely processing in and the delivery of required materials;
- Provide basic program assistance to school districts and design professionals on the CHPS Criteria and the CHPS Verified and CHPS Designed program requirements;
- Screen CHPS Verified project documentation for prerequisites and credits per the CHPS Criteria rating system;
- Assist in quality control (QC) review of work done by external CHPS Verified reviewers;
- Assist in conceiving, developing and implementing improvements to the certification review process based on personal knowledge and experience, and/or user feedback

The Collaborative for High Performance Schools believes kids learn better in schools with good lighting, clean air, and comfortable classrooms. That’s why CHPS works with schools and experts to make changes to ensure that every child has the best possible learning environment with the smallest impact on the planet.
